SQL语句大全实例教程图解
SQL是Structured Query Language(结构化查询语言)的缩写,是一种被广泛使用的数据库管理系统语言。作为一名数据库开发者或管理员,掌握 SQL 语句是至关重要的技能之一。本文将介绍 SQL 语句的常见操作,并提供实例教程和图解,帮助初学者更好地了解 SQL 语句的应用。
一、常见的SQL语句
1. DDL语句:用来定义数据库模式,包括创建、修改、删除表以及定义表之间的联系。DDL语句的核心命令有:CREATE、ALTER和DROP。
2. DML语句:用来操作数据,包括数据的增加、修改、查询和删除。DML语句的核心命令有:INSERT、UPDATE、SELECT和DELETE。
3. DCL语句:用来控制访问数据库的权限和安全性。DCL语句的核心命令有:GRANT和REVOKE。
二、SQL语句实例教程
1. 创建数据表
SQL语句可以用来创建数据表,下面是一段创建数据表的代码:
```
CREATE TABLE students (
id INTEGER P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
gender CHAR(1),
age INTEGER,
score FLOAT
);
```
以上语句创建了一个名为“students”的数据表,数据表包含五个列,它们分别是:id、name、gender、age和score。其中,id是主键,且使用了自动递增的方式(AUTO_INCREMENT)。VARCHAR(50)表示name列是一个最长为50个字符的字符串列,CHAR(1)表示gender列是一个最长为1个字符的字符串列,INTEGER表示age列是一个整数列,而FLOAT则表示score列是一个浮点数列。
2. 插入数据
用SQL语句可以很方便地向数据表中插入数据,下面是一段向数据表中插入一条数据的代码:
```
INSERT INTO students (name, gender, age, score)
VALUES ('张三', '男', 20, 80.5);
```
以上语句将一条数据插入到了名为“students”的数据表中,这条数据包含四个字段的值,分别是:name、gender、age和score。可以看到,SQL语句中使用了INSERT INTO关键字来将数据插入到数据表中,然后使用VALUES关键字指定要插入的具体数值。
3. 更新数据
如果需要更新数据表中的记录,可以使用SQL语句中的UPDATE命令。下面是一段更新数据的代码:
```
UPDATE students SET score = 90 WHERE name = '张三';
```
以上代码将“students”数据表中名为“张三”的记录的score值修改为90。可以看到,SQL语句中使用了UPDATE关键字来表示要进行更新操作,然后使用SET关键字指定要更新的字段和具体的数值,通过WHERE子句指定要更新的记录的条件。
三、SQL语句图解
SQL语句可以直观展示成一张图表,以下是SQL语句的流程图:
![SQL语句流程图](https://cdn.educba.com/academy/wp-content/uploads/2019/06/SQL-Commands.png)
以上图表是SQL语句的基本流程图,其中包括了SQL语法的三个主要部分:SELECT、FROM和WHERE。SELECT表示要选择的字段,FROM表示要选择的表,而WHERE则表示选择的条件。
总结
本文介绍了SQL语句的三种类型:DDL、DML和DCL。并在实例教程的基础上,帮助初学者了解了SQL语句的常用操作,并通过流程图直观展示了SQL语句的基本结构和流程。尽管SQL语句的使用方法非常多,但是通过本文的介绍,相信读者已经对SQL语句有了一定的了解和应用能力。
如果您的问题还未解决可以联系站长付费协助。
有问题可以加入技术QQ群一起交流学习
本站vip会员 请加入无忧模板网 VIP群(50604020) PS:加入时备注用户名或昵称
普通注册会员或访客 请加入无忧模板网 技术交流群(50604130)
客服微信号:15898888535
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若内容侵犯了原著者的合法权益,可联系站长删除。